    Job Description

    The purpose of this role is to manage service delivery of a programme of planned preventative maintenance of building services activities across a large property portfolio.

    The role will include ensuring that all statutory compliance requirements are planned, and tasks are scheduled to the maintenance standards in line with client requirements.

    Job Responsibilities


    • Managing & supporting the activities of PPM Coordinators ensuring compliance to all contractual and statutory requirements

    • Management of live Risk Register to agreed standards.

    • Ensuring that all documentation is uploaded to the Management Information System within the timescales set out in the contracts.

    • Monitor & Report on productivity of teams & implement initiatives to increase same

    • Manage the Change Control process to ensure that changes to assets, standards, frequencies, resource, or dates are recorded, assessed for operational and commercial impact implemented in a controlled manner.

    • Support & Guide co-ordination of all work orders both planned and unplanned.

    • Lead the digital transformation and integration of MIS System across all areas of the contract by providing training & support to the wider Contract team.

    • Schedule PPM task frequencies based on contractual maintenance standards.

    • Ensuring components and spares are delivered to site on a just in time basis and be available for Service Technicians on their scheduled days.

    • Audit of task reporting for Quality and compliance, report any discrepancies or poor reporting to the Hard Services Manager and Account Director

    • In conjunction with the Hard Services Manager develop an Asset Management Programme that identifies, tracks, and records the life cycle of key assets.

    • Prepare Data trends & Analysis for senior management along with other Adhoc Reporting.

    • Delivery of training and awareness to technical and non-technical staff as necessary
